Independent Domestic Violence Advocate

Our client, based in Essex, is currently recruiting for a Independent Domestic Violence Advocate (IDVA) on a permanent contract. Our client is proud to have played an integral part of the local South Essex community for over forty years. Over this time they have supported thousands of women and children to escape abusive their relationships.

The position is due to start in July on a full time basis with the annual salary for this role being £25,000.

The ideal candidate will have a minimum of two years’ experience working within Domestic Violence.

Duties will include (but not limited to):

  • Delivering high quality and responsive support to a caseload of 20-25 Domestic Violence victims
  • Identify and assess the risks and needs of domestic abuse survivors using an evidence- based risk identification checklist
  • Focus on and prioritise high risk cases and provide a proactive, short to medium term crisis intervention service
  • Work within a multi-agency setting to address the safety of high-risk survivors and ensure that their safety plans are co-ordinated particularly through the Multi-Agency Risk Assessment Conference (MARAC)

Skills, knowledge and expertise required:

  • Significant experience working with clients who have suffered domestic abuse
  • Experience providing advice to survivors of domestic abuse
  • Experience of case preperation and attening MARAC sessions

Working hours

  • 35 hours per week
  • Monday – Friday 9am-5pm
